Разработка, производство и продажа радиоэлектронной аппаратуры
|
Требуется программист в Зеленограде - обработка данных с датчиков; ColdFire; 40 тыс.
e-mail: jobsmp@pochta.ru
|
Уточненное описание проблемы
/////////////////////////////////////////////////////////////////
Тип процессора: TMS320C6414 TGLZ
ревизия A7
Внутрисхемные JTAG отладчики:
GAO XDS510 USB
СКАН Инжиниринг-Телеком SDSP-PP
Texas Instr. XDS560 (оригинальный отладчик)
ПО:
CCS ver 3.1
CCS ver 3.3 Platinum ED
/////////////////////////////////////////////////////////////////
При загрузке прошивки через ЖТАГ
дыннй эффект наблюдается со всеми перечисленными (и имеющимися)
отладчиками и версиями CCS.
Суть эффекта заключается в копировании данных
с адреса 0xzzzz00 на 0xzzzz20.
копируется 32 байта один в один.
Тот же эффект наблюдается с адресами
0xzzzz40 на 0xzzzz60 и тд.
Для наглядности привожу текст из окошка дизасма код-студии
копия по адресу 0x220 байт в байт с адресом 0x200
00000200 boot.asm:26:59$, pizdets:
00000200 00803028 MVK.S1 0x0060,A1
00000204 05003028 MVK.S1 0x0060,A10
00000208 00803028 MVK.S1 0x0060,A1
0000020C 05003028 MVK.S1 0x0060,A10
00000210 00A80274 STW.D1T1 A1,*+A10[0x0]
00000214 00008000 NOP 5
00000218 01280264 LDW.D1T1 *+A10[0x0],A2
0000021C 00008000 NOP 5
00000220 00803028 MVK.S1 0x0060,A1
00000224 05003028 MVK.S1 0x0060,A10
00000228 00803028 MVK.S1 0x0060,A1
0000022C 05003028 MVK.S1 0x0060,A10
00000230 00A80274 STW.D1T1 A1,*+A10[0x0]
00000234 00008000 NOP 5
00000238 01280264 LDW.D1T1 *+A10[0x0],A2
0000023C 00008000 NOP 5
00000240 00008000 NOP 5
/////////////////////////////////////////////////////////////////
Еще раз повторюсь что прошивка заливается с ЖТАГА,
никакой внешней памяти у ДСП нет.
Возможно это поможет более точно разобраться в косяках
Составить ответ | Вернуться на конференцию
Ответы